Athletic Event Production

WHAT IS IT?

The Citytri Event Xperience is an opportunity for young people to learn about the world of athletic event production. This world is exciting but tough and it provides anyone willing to join with a chance to learn about the basics for all event production. In other words, this experience can be applied to non-athletic events as well.

The Citytri Event Xperience is completed through one of NYC's premier running organizations, Citytri Runs, and 15 half marathons that are produced in the NYC area each year. Each event brings hundreds of adult amature runners together to race 13.1 Miles through some of the most historic parks in the area.

Citytri Event Xperience participants will learn prior to each event about how an event is created, marketed, and produced. During each event the participant will learn how to organize and establish a venue and initiate an outdoor event in under two hours. They will learn customer service skills in an environment that is both challenging in time and conditions.

WHO IS THIS FOR?

High School and Community College Students looking for meaningful resume worthy experiences. Students who are good communicators (can easily speak up at home, with friends, or at school), have an interest and capacity to learn about customer service and basic event production are invited to apply.

Additionally, students who can focus on a specific responsibility and can work on their own and with a team are preferable. Team skills and the ability to adapt to changing situations are also important.

The pre and post event responsibilities will require online communication and possibly some use of online tools. If students have skills in this area it is important that they share this information. Event day responsibilities require arriving at the venue, rain or shine, at 6 AM and that they remain until 1 PM. During that time students will be required to take on event day responsibilities related to the management of participants, media, and the course. All participants are required to complete 5 events over a 12 month period. Applications are accepted on a rolling basis.

what do you get?

Every participant who completes the Citytri Event Xperience is provided the following.

1. Description of responsibilities held and areas of learning for use in resume.

2. Letter of reference describing accomplishments.

3. Certificate of completion as Level 1 Citytri Event Production Assistant.

4. Placement in Citytri Event Recruitment Pool.

5. Stipend - To cover your transportation and meal expenses.
